How Often Should Pest Control Be Done In Bangalore Homes?

For most Bengaluru apartments and independent homes, a good thumb rule is a pest control frequency of once every 4-6 months for general pests like ants, cockroaches and silverfish. That usually keeps activity low through both summer and monsoon.

If you've had a serious infestation in the past year – heavy cockroach activity, bed bugs, or rodents – plan a more aggressive schedule for the next 12 months, then move back to maintenance visits once things stabilise.

How Often Should Pest Control Be Done: Quick Scenarios

In a typical 2BHK in a gated community, a yearly plan with two visits is usually enough as a baseline home pest control schedule, unless there's a specific issue like bed bugs. Smaller 1BHK homes with good maintenance and no pets can often work with a single annual visit plus a quick inspection mid-year.

On the other hand, if your flat is on the ground floor facing a garden or open drain, expect to need service at least three times a year for the first cycle to keep cockroaches and mosquitoes under control.

Seasonal Pest Control Schedule For Bangalore's Climate

Bengaluru's relatively mild temperatures hide one important detail: pests stay active almost all year, which has a direct impact on your pest control schedule. The patterns change slightly between pre-monsoon, monsoon, and the cooler months.

Think of your year in three blocks – March to May, June to October, and November to February – and plan treatment dates just before the two main activity spikes.

Monsoon And Post-Monsoon: High-Risk Period

Monsoon (June-October) is the peak time for cockroaches, flies, and mosquitoes, so pest management is most effective if you schedule a visit right before the rains start. The chemicals have time to settle, and you get maximum protection when dampness and organic waste attract insects.

Post-monsoon is when you might start seeing more spiders and occasional termites, especially in lower floors and older buildings that already had moisture problems.

Summer And Cooler Months: Maintenance Mode

Pre-summer treatment in March or April is usually when technicians focus on cracks, drains, balconies, and utility ducts for long-lasting residential pest control. The goal here is to block the easy entry points before pests become active again.

Through November to February, you may not see as many crawling insects, but rodents and ants tend to move indoors for warmth and food, so you still need to keep an eye out.

Annual Pest Control Vs More Frequent Visits

Many Bengaluru households try to manage with just annual pest control, often linked to building maintenance or society drives. That can work if the building is well maintained, garbage is handled properly, and there's no major history of infestation.

The catch is that chemicals don't last forever. Most gel and spray treatments for common pests have a residual effect of three to five months in real-world conditions, sometimes less if the house is cleaned heavily — which is exactly why follow-up treatment matters as much as the first visit.

When Once A Year Is Enough

If your flat is on a higher floor, has good ventilation, and no open drains nearby, yearly preventive pest control is usually sufficient. This applies especially to newer constructions with sealed windows and good plumbing.

Families that cook less often at home, or keep a strict cleaning routine around the kitchen and utility areas, can often stretch the gap between visits without seeing a spike in activity.

When You Need Quarterly Or Bi-Monthly Visits

Ground and first-floor homes next to vacant plots, stormwater drains, lakes, or open garbage spots almost always need a tighter pest prevention plan. In these cases, quarterly visits are realistic rather than "extra".

Homes with elderly people, infants, or immunocompromised family members also benefit from more frequent treatments, because small pest issues can quickly become health concerns.

How To Build A Practical Pest Control Plan For Your Home

A good plan isn't just about booking a service; it combines treatment with habit changes so your next home pest control session can be on maintenance rather than crisis mode. That starts with checking how pests are getting in and what's keeping them there.

Spend a weekend tracking three things: sources of moisture, gaps and cracks, and regular food sources that might be encouraging insects and rodents.

Simple Steps Between Professional Visits

Small tweaks in routine can extend the gap between professional pest prevention services. Basic things like clearing kitchen counters at night, sealing snack containers, and washing dustbins weekly go a long way.

On balconies and utility areas, avoid storing cardboard boxes on the floor, since they attract cockroaches and provide perfect hiding places between pest control Bangalore visits.

If you keep pets, clean their feeding area soon after meals and store food in sealed containers, as spillage is a major draw for ants and cockroaches.

Frequently Asked Questions

How often should pest control be done in Bangalore homes?

For most apartments and independent homes, once every 4-6 months for general pests like ants, cockroaches and silverfish is a good baseline. If you've had a serious infestation in the past year, plan a more aggressive schedule for the next 12 months before moving back to maintenance visits.

Is once-a-year pest control enough?

It can be, if your flat is on a higher floor, has good ventilation, and no open drains nearby — this applies especially to newer constructions with sealed windows and good plumbing. Ground and first-floor homes near vacant plots, drains, or garbage spots usually need quarterly visits instead.

How long do pest control chemicals actually last?

Most gel and spray treatments for common pests have a residual effect of three to five months in real-world conditions, sometimes less if the house is cleaned heavily — which is why follow-up visits matter as much as the first treatment.

How many visits does a bed bug infestation need?

A minimum of two visits spaced 10-15 days apart, often with a third inspection visit, and a follow-up pest inspection every 6 months if you've had repeat issues.

Does the type of pest change how often I need treatment?

Yes. Cockroaches and ants typically need one major treatment plus a follow-up after 3-4 months, rodents need multiple visits over 4-6 weeks to close entry points, and termites need a full barrier or drilling treatment followed by a yearly inspection.

When should I call a pest control professional immediately instead of waiting for my next scheduled visit?

Call right away if you see live or dead cockroaches in the daytime, bed bug stains or repeated bites, rodent droppings or noises in false ceilings, or mud tubes and hollow-sounding wood that could indicate termites.
